Habitat for Humanity Responds in Haiti On January 12, 2010, an earthquake with a magnitude of 7.0 struck the Caribbean nation of Haiti - approximately 20 km west of the capital, Port-au-Prince. Thousands of buildings and homes were destroyed. Millions of people were affected, and more than 1 million people were left displaced or homeless.
Habitat’s Response in Haiti Habitat for Humanity is implementing immediate relief efforts, addressing long-term shelter solutions for low-income families. Habitat has set the bold goal of serving 50,000 earthquake-affected families in the next five years.
Based on current information and past experience with international disasters, Habitat is planning a multiphase strategy response:
1) Relief – Emergency Shelter Kits
